Title :
A scalable Video Communication Framework based on D-Bus

Abstract :
Applications for video communication support that individuals or organizations share video and voice in different places. However, most of existing applications are proprietary systems that lack generality. In this paper, we present a common framework which named VCF (Video Communication Framework) for these applications. The architecture of this framework is modular, and is based on the D-Bus inter-process communication solution. To evaluate this framework we designed a video conference system for attending conference over IPv4/IPv6. The architecture and experiments shows the good scalability and robustness of VCF in the video application development.
